Item Description

1971 SICARD SNOMASTER VIN:W10282 WITH 2702 HOURS ON THE CHASSIS. THE DRIVE MOTOR IS A CUMMINS 4B CONNECTED TO AN ALLISON AT542 TRANSMISSION. THE BLOWER MOTOR IS A CUMMINS 8.3L.

CURRENTLY IN STORAGE, BUT IS READY FOR SNOW PICKUP. REAR STARTER HANGS UP, BUT OTHER THAN A FLUID CHECK AND GREASE, IT IS READY TO WORK. THE TOWN HAS OWNED THIS UNIT SINCE NEW AND HAS MOVED ONTO A LOADER MOUNTED BLOWER.
